API |
アクセス許可 |
説明 |
タイプ |
必要となる理由 |
Office 365 Exchange Online |
Full_access_as_app |
Use Exchange Web Services with full access to all mailboxes |
アプリケーション |
すべてのメールボックスからアイテムを取得します。 |
Exchange.ManageAsApp |
Manage Exchange As Application |
アプリケーション |
Exchange PowerShell を使用してメールボックスの権限を取得します。 | |
Microsoft Graph |
ChannelMember.ReadWrite.All |
Add and remove members from all channels |
アプリケーション |
プライベート チャネルおよび共有チャネルのメンバーを移行先に移行します。 |
Chat.Read.All |
Read all chat messages |
アプリケーション |
チャット データを取得します。 | |
Domain.Read.All |
Read domains |
アプリケーション |
Fly Server で接続を追加します。 | |
Files.Read.All |
Read OneDrive data |
アプリケーション |
OneDrive ファイルを取得して移行します。 | |
Group.ReadWrite.All |
Read and write all groups |
アプリケーション |
Microsoft 365 グループおよびグループ データを移行先に移行します。 | |
Sites.ReadWrite.All |
Read and write items in all site collections |
アプリケーション |
チーム サイトおよびプライベート / 共有チャネルのサイト コレクションのチャネル フォルダーおよびファイルを移行先に移行します。 | |
TeamMember.ReadWrite.All |
Add and remove members from all teams |
アプリケーション |
チーム メンバーを移行先に移行します。 | |
Team.Create |
Create teams |
アプリケーション |
移行先でチームを作成します。 | |
TeamSettings.ReadWrite.All |
Read and change all teams' settings |
アプリケーション |
チーム設定を移行先に移行します。 | |
TeamsAppInstallation.ReadWriteForTeam.All |
Manage Teams apps for all teams |
アプリケーション |
チーム アプリを移行先に移行します。 | |
TeamsTab.ReadWriteForTeam.All |
Allow the Teams app to manage all tabs for all teams |
アプリケーション |
チーム タブを移行先に移行します。 | |
ChannelSettings.ReadWrite.All |
Read and write the names, descriptions, and settings of all channels |
アプリケーション |
チャネル設定を移行先に移行します。 | |
Channel.Create |
Create channels |
アプリケーション |
移行先でチャネルを作成します。 | |
Teamwork.Migrate.All |
Create chat and channel messages with anyone's identity and with any timestamp |
アプリケーション |
詳細 方法を使用した移行でのみが必要です。 | |
TeamworkTag.ReadWrite.All |
Read and write tags in Teams |
アプリケーション |
タグを移行先に移行します。 | |
InformationProtectionPolicy.Read.All |
Read all published labels and label policies for an organization. |
アプリケーション |
移行中に秘密度ラベルを管理する場合にのみ必要です。 | |
User.ReadWrite.All |
Read and write all users’ full profiles |
アプリケーション |
移行先ユーザーに対して、Microsoft 365 ライセンスの割り当ておよびメールボックスのプロビジョニングを実行する場合に必要です。 | |
Schedule.ReadWrite.All |
Read and write all schedule items |
アプリケーション |
||
SharePoint |
Sites.FullControl.All |
Have full control of all site collections |
アプリケーション |
|
User.Read.All |
Read user profiles |
アプリケーション |
OneDrive for Business のユーザー名で、移行先 OneDrive for Business サイトの URL を取得する場合にのみ必要です。 | |
TermStore.ReadWrite.All |
Read and write managed metadata |
アプリケーション |
Managed Metadata Service を移行先に移行します。 | |
Azure Rights Management Services |
Content.DelegatedReader |
Read protected content on behalf of a user |
アプリケーション |
移行中に秘密度ラベルを管理する場合にのみ必要です。 |
Content.DelegatedWriter |
Create protected content on behalf of a user |
アプリケーション | ||
Content.SuperUser |
Read all protected content for this tenant |
アプリケーション | ||
Content.Writer |
Create protected content |
アプリケーション | ||
Microsoft Information Protection Sync Service |
UnifiedPolicy.Tenant.Read |
Read all unified policies of the tenant. |
アプリケーション |
移行中に秘密度ラベルを管理する場合にのみ必要です。 |
*注意: 以下のコマンドを使用して、マニフェスト を介して必要な API 権限を追加することができます。
"requiredResourceAccess": [
{
"resourceAppId": "00000012-0000-0000-c000-000000000000",
"resourceAccess": [
{
"id": "006e763d-a822-41fc-8df5-8d3d7fe20022",
"type": "Role"
},
{
"id": "7347eb49-7a1a-43c5-8eac-a5cd1d1c7cf0",
"type": "Role"
},
{
"id": "7f740376-647b-4ad7-9ff7-292af252707a",
"type": "Role"
},
{
"id": "d13f921c-7f21-4c08-bade-db9d048bd0da",
"type": "Role"
}
]
},
{
"resourceAppId": "00000003-0000-0ff1-ce00-000000000000",
"resourceAccess": [
{
"id": "df021288-bdef-4463-88db-98f22de89214",
"type": "Role"
},
{
"id": "c8e3537c-ec53-43b9-bed3-b2bd3617ae97",
"type": "Role"
},
{
"id": "678536fe-1083-478a-9c59-b99265e6b0d3",
"type": "Role"
}
]
},
{
"resourceAppId": "00000003-0000-0000-c000-000000000000",
"resourceAccess": [
{
"id": "62a82d76-70ea-41e2-9197-370581804d09",
"type": "Role"
},
{
"id": "a3371ca5-911d-46d6-901c-42c8c7a937d8",
"type": "Role"
},
{
"id": "9492366f-7969-46a4-8d15-ed1a20078fff",
"type": "Role"
},
{
"id": "19da66cb-0fb0-4390-b071-ebc76a349482",
"type": "Role"
},
{
"id": "01d4889c-1287-42c6-ac1f-5d1e02578ef6",
"type": "Role"
},
{
"id": "741f803b-c850-494e-b5df-cde7c675a1ca",
"type": "Role"
},
{
"id": "6b7d71aa-70aa-4810-a8d9-5d9fb2830017",
"type": "Role"
},
{
"id": "b7760610-0545-4e8a-9ec3-cce9e63db01c",
"type": "Role"
},
{
"id": "dbb9058a-0e50-45d7-ae91-66909b5d4664",
"type": "Role"
},
{
"id": "f3a65bd4-b703-46df-8f7e-0174fea562aa",
"type": "Role"
},
{
"id": "243cded2-bd16-4fd6-a953-ff8177894c3d",
"type": "Role"
},
{
"id": "bdd80a03-d9bc-451d-b7c4-ce7c63fe3c8f",
"type": "Role"
},
{
"id": "0121dc95-1b9f-4aed-8bac-58c5ac466691",
"type": "Role"
},
{
"id": "35930dcf-aceb-4bd1-b99a-8ffed403c974",
"type": "Role"
},
{
"id": "dfb0dd15-61de-45b2-be36-d6a69fba3c79",
"type": "Role"
},
{
"id": "5dad17ba-f6cc-4954-a5a2-a0dcc95154f0",
"type": "Role"
},
{
"id": "23fc2474-f741-46ce-8465-674744c5c361",
"type": "Role"
},
{
"id": "6163d4f4-fbf8-43da-a7b4-060fe85ed148",
"type": "Role"
}
]
},
{
"resourceAppId": "00000002-0000-0ff1-ce00-000000000000",
"resourceAccess": [
{
"id": "dc890d15-9560-4a4c-9b7f-a736ec74ec40",
"type": "Role"
},
{
"id": "dc50a0fb-09a3-484d-be87-e023b12c6440",
"type": "Role"
}
]
},
{
"resourceAppId": "870c4f2e-85b6-4d43-bdda-6ed9a579b725",
"resourceAccess": [
{
"id": "8b2071cd-015a-4025-8052-1c0dba2d3f64",
"type": "Role"
}
]
}
],